![]() Typically you will always find in the polls of whats most important to a consumer that the top three things will be (in order);
1. Customer Service 2. Selection 3. Price I am always willing to pay a bit more for better service and the retailer / wholesaler having the products on hand that I want. There are places that I know sell some things that I get on a regular basis for work for less than what I pay.... but I just find that not having to deal with certain people or stores is just not worth saving the few bucks.

![]() I chose customer service and price. I refuse to accept that if a store in Vancouver can ship it to me (for free) in Central Alberta, the Calgary stores "can't match the price because of extra shipping" and I have NOT found a single store in Calgary that comes close to what I can buy drygoods for "shipping-in" from the coast. As a result, I do probably 90% of my drygoods business online with t5 bulbs and "odds and ends" being the only things I tend to buy locally. I realize most stores will price match, but really when the info is out there for anyone to see online I really shouldn't have to beg.
My other beef with the local stores, is I can buy the EXACT same products from each and every one of them (talking dry-goods here) They all carry the same lines of T5 bulbs, powerheads, T5 reflectors, MH Ballasts, etc. so if I want something different like say an ATI bulb I have to mail order it in. I know there are other considerations when deciding what to stock but I can't figure out the logic because at that point all you are competing on is Price. Anyways, my point here was that variety of products to choose from should be on the list As far as livestock goes, I don't like ordering online as I've had poor luck in the past and I like to actually see what I'm buying. In the livestock department I'm very happy to see that the local stores diversify and have different things as health of livestock and honest, knowledgeable customer service is extremely important. If I don't feel I can trust the word of the guy selling me the fish/coral I won't buy. |
